在跨平台开发中,源代码加密面临着一些独特的挑战。跨平台开发通常需要使用多种开发语言和框架,不同的平台对源代码加密的支持程度和要求也有所不同。例如,在一些移动平台和桌面平台上,加密算法的实现和调用方式可能存在差异,这就给源代码加密的统一实施带来了困难。为了应对这些挑战,开发人员可以采用一些跨平台的加密库和工具。这些加密库提供了统一的接口和功能,能够在不同的平台上实现相同的加密效果。同时,在跨平台开发过程中,要对源代码进行合理的分层和模块化设计,将需要加密的中心模块进行独自封装,减少因平台差异带来的加密问题。此外,还需要对不同平台的加密性能进行测试和优化,确保加密操作不会对应用程序的性能产生明显的影响,从而在跨平台开发中实现源代码的有效加密保护。对传媒行业内容管理系统的源代码加密,保护媒体资源的安全。中国澳门操作简单适用性强源代码加密加密软件推荐

在网络环境下,源代码的传输是不可避免的,例如开发团队成员之间的代码共享、将代码上传到版本控制系统等。然而,网络环境存在诸多安全隐患,如网络偷听、中间人攻击等,这些都可能导致源代码在传输过程中被窃取或篡改。因此,网络源代码加密是保障数据传输安全的重要手段。采用安全的传输协议,如SSL/TLS协议,对源代码在传输过程中的数据进行加密。SSL/TLS协议通过使用对称加密和非对称加密技术,在传输双方建立安全的通信通道,确保源代码在传输过程中以密文形式存在。同时,在网络源代码加密过程中,还可以结合数字签名技术,对传输的源代码进行签名验证。数字签名可以确保源代码的完整性和真实性,防止源代码在传输过程中被篡改。通过这些网络源代码加密措施,能够有效保障源代码在网络传输过程中的安全性。上海适合企业源代码加密加密软件在实施源代码加密的过程中,还需留意与其它安全策略的整合与配合,以构建一个多方位的安全防护机制。

信息安全领域不断发展,新的安全威胁和攻击手段层出不穷。为了应对这些新的安全威胁,源代码加密需要定期进行更新与维护。加密算法可能会随着时间的推移和计算能力的提升而被解惑,因此需要及时更新加密算法,采用更安全、更先进的加密技术。同时,加密软件和工具也可能存在安全漏洞,开发者需要及时发布补丁进行修复。企业或个人开发者应建立定期更新和维护源代码加密的机制,关注安全领域的较新动态,及时了解新的安全威胁和解决方案。通过定期更新与维护,确保源代码加密始终能够提供有效的安全保护,保障源代码的安全性和保密性。
开源项目以其开放性和协作性受到普遍关注,然而,开源项目也面临着源代码泄露和安全漏洞等风险。源代码加密在开源项目中可以发挥一定的作用,但同时也面临着一些挑战。在开源项目中,可以通过对部分中心源代码进行加密处理,保护项目的关键技术和商业秘密。例如,对于一些具有独特算法或创新功能的代码模块,可以采用加密方式限制其访问权限,只向特定的合作伙伴或贡献者开放。然而,开源项目的开放性要求源代码在一定程度上是可访问和可修改的,这与源代码加密的封闭性存在一定的矛盾。因此,在应用源代码加密时,需要平衡好安全性和开放性的关系。可以通过制定合理的加密策略和授权机制,确保在保护中心源代码的同时,不影响开源项目的正常发展和社区协作。同时,开源项目还需要加强对加密密钥的管理,防止密钥泄露导致加密失效。源代码加密技术有助于防止恶意攻击者通过分析代码来寻找软件的漏洞。

开源项目在软件开发领域发挥着重要的作用,它促进了知识的共享和技术的创新。然而,在开源项目中,电脑文件源代码加密同样不可或缺。虽然开源项目强调代码的开放性和共享性,但这并不意味着可以忽视代码的安全性。在开源项目中,不同的贡献者来自不同的背景和地区,他们的开发环境和安全意识也存在差异。通过电脑文件源代码加密,可以对项目的中心代码或敏感部分进行保护,防止因个别贡献者的不当操作或恶意行为导致代码泄露或损坏。同时,加密技术还可以用于管理代码的版本和权限。例如,项目负责人可以对不同版本的代码进行加密标记,只有授权的贡献者才能访问和修改特定版本的代码。这样可以确保项目的开发过程有序进行,避免出现代码混乱和矛盾的问题。跨平台开发时,确保源代码加密方案在各平台上都能稳定运行。四川操作简单适用性强源代码加密厂家
源代码加密与数字签名结合,既能保护代码又能验证代码的完整性和真实性。中国澳门操作简单适用性强源代码加密加密软件推荐
企业部署源代码加密需要制定合理的策略和详细的步骤。首先,企业要对自身的源代码资产进行全方面评估,了解哪些源代码文件需要加密以及加密的优先级。然后,根据企业的规模和安全需求,选择合适的加密技术和工具。对于大型企业,可以考虑采用集中式的源代码加密管理系统,它可以统一管理企业的所有源代码加密任务,包括密钥管理、用户权限分配等。在部署过程中,要先进行小范围的试点测试,确保加密系统能够正常工作且不影响开发流程。接着,对开发人员进行培训,让他们熟悉加密系统的使用方法和注意事项。然后,逐步将加密系统推广到整个企业,并对加密效果进行持续监控和评估,根据实际情况进行调整和优化。中国澳门操作简单适用性强源代码加密加密软件推荐